Dav Whatmore, Sri Lankan-Australian cricketer and coach

Davenell Frederick Whatmore (born 16 March 1954) is a Sri Lanka born Australian cricket coach and former cricketer.

A right-handed batsman, Whatmore played seven Test matches for Australia in 1979, and one One Day International in 1980. At first-class level, he scored over 6,000 runs for Victoria. Since the 1990s, Whatmore has coached several national cricket teams including the Sri Lanka, Bangladesh and Pakistan. He was the Head coach of Sri Lanka when Sri Lanka won the Cricket World Cup in 1996.

He also served as the coach of the Zimbabwe team before being sacked for poor performances in 2016 ICC World Twenty20

.Currently he is the head coach of Nepal Cricket team.
